« Reply #2905 on: October 19, 2011, 10:55:52 am »

Hi everyone,

Still plugging away at the application, meds were done last week and things are finally beginning to come together. We too should have ours sent off by the first week in November.

Pinklady- I saw you mentioned the Option C printout, is it applicable for outland spousal applications? 

Yes if the sponsor lives in Canada. If not you can do as AnnaMcG did.
It is one of the required docs on the document checklist.

Good luck getting the application together, hope you can send it soon!
